2016 Masters Swimming Victoria
Long Course Championships
A Chance to have a Long Course ‘hit-out’ before the Nationals & test out the fantastic facilities at the new Ringwood pool |
EVENT DETAILS
DATE Sunday 20th March 2016
TIME Warm up – 1:15pm
(Separate cool-down/warm-up facilities will exist for the remainder of the meet).
Start – 2:00pm
VENUE Aquanation – Ringwood Aquatic & Leisure Centre
Reilly St & Greenwood Ave, Ringwood VIC 3134
50m Indoor Competition Pool
COST Registration $30
Individual Event Event fees included in the Registration
(A maximum of 3 events per swimmer)
Relays No Relays

IMPORTANT INFORMATION FOR ALL SWIMMERS
Closing date is 5.00pm Friday 11th March 2016 – NO LATE ENTRIES
If you discover a recording mistake or an event is missing you may contact the Masters Swimming Victoria Office via mail, email (see above) or in person and provide the following details: Name, event, heat, lane, time and description.
NO changes can be made after Tuesday 15th March at 12.00pm (noon) FOR ANY REASON
All swimmers must register entries via the Club Assistant online registration system.
Please ensure that your Masters Swimming registration is current to 31st December 2016.
Club Assistant validates your membership and will reject your entry attempt if you are not financial for the 2016 season.
This competition will be governed by the
Rules of Masters Swimming Australia in force on the closing date for entries. (These can be found on the Masters Swimming Australia website)
Medals for first place and
ribbons for second and third place will be awarded for all age groups and sexes, based on fastest times. Visiting interstate and International teams are eligible for awards.
A fee of $30 will be applied to any protest other than a recording issue. This fee must be attached to the protest form at the time of lodgment. No fee, no protest accepted.
Visiting interstate and international swimmers are welcome. Visitors must show a proof of registration with an equivalent body overseas or interstate.
No guest swimmers!
